How much does it cost to rent a home in Locust Gap?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Locust Gap 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,278 | $695 | $1,750 |
Locust Gap 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,626 | $850 | $2,500 |
Locust Gap 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,323 | $895 | $1,895 |
Locust Gap 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,895 | $2,895 | $2,895 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Locust Gap
What type of rentals are currently available in Locust Gap?
There are currently 41 Apartments for Rent in Locust Gap, PA with pricing that ranges from $725 to $3,645. There are also 38 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Locust Gap ranging from $695 to $2,895.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Locust Gap?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Locust Gap ranges from $695 to $2,895 with an average monthly rent of $1,644.
